Requirements

  • Maintains all licenses as required by the State Department of Insurance to provide risk management consulting or risk transfer solutions as necessary in states where the firm functions (or be willing and able to obtain all required licenses within the first 90 days of employment)
  • Self-starter with the ability to influence others through effective verbal and written presentation skills
  • Intermediate to advanced knowledge of Microsoft Word, Excel, Publisher, and PowerPoint, and the ability to learn any other appropriate insurance company and firm software programs
  • Demonstrates core values, exuding behavior that is aligned with corporate culture

Responsibilities

  • Presents proposals in a professional manner, reviewing coverages in detail to ensure understanding
  • Communicates with clients, prospects, insurance company partners, and service team in an articulate and effective manner
  • Finalizes the sale and collects necessary documents, applications, etc., and briefs the service team on the policy sale
  • Develops prospects by becoming involved in community affiliations, attending insurance company partner hosted seminars, building and maintaining relationships with industry contacts, engaging in networking events and through referrals from current accounts
  • Develops information and recommendations for prospective accounts, presents proposals and adheres to firm policies and procedures for writing a new account
  • Maintains a concern for accuracy, timeliness and completion when interacting with current and prospective clients, the Firm and Insurance Company Partners, to minimize potential for errors and omissions claims while demonstrating strong organizational skills with a high attention to detail
  • Maintains understanding and knowledge of the insurance industry and underwriting criteria for insurance company partners represented by the firm to effectively communicate to all involved
  • Positively represents the firm in the community and with our insurance company partners
  • Performs other functions as assigned by leadership
  • Looks for opportunities to improve the firm, business segment, and processes
  • Brings issues and discrepancies to the attention of appropriate leadership
  • Is expected to meet monthly new business goals

About Foundation Risk Partners

Foundation Risk Partners operates as an insurance brokerage and consulting firm, focusing on providing tailored insurance solutions and expert advice to clients across the United States. The company grows by acquiring other firms and expanding its services organically, ensuring a diverse mix of industry knowledge and specialized services. Their approach combines expertise in various sectors with a commitment to cultural alignment and shared values. Unlike many competitors, Foundation Risk Partners emphasizes a collaborative relationship with clients, aiming to achieve exceptional outcomes and drive success for their partners.
